But nonetheless distinctive we thought we have been, latest research reveals we are probably wired to replicate one another’s tastes.
A new study through the college of St Andrew’s, published inside log Scientific Reports, enjoys learned that males have an „attractiveness improve“ when they are picked by other people.
For your research, a small grouping of 49 women happened to be found men’s room confronts and conceptual works of art. These people were questioned to rate the appeal of this pictures on a size of 1 to 100, chances are they had been revealed how different lady had scored them, and asked to reconsider their particular solution.
Information revealed girls reassessed their own viewpoints once they realized exactly what rest considered. If it was actually uncovered that additional female provided the man an increased rating, participants were very likely to set their score as higher too.
„Mate-choice copying,“ whenever a specific discovers possible lovers more attractive when they have been already plumped for by somebody else, takes place throughout the animal kingdom. In birds and fish kinds, it can help women pick top-notch men, and an evolutionary benefit.
